Both cities are served by several airports, giving flexibility on slots and routing:
Kathmandu, Nepal: Tribhuvan International Airport.
Varanasi, India: Lal Bahadur Shastri International Airport.
| Tribhuvan International Airport | Lal Bahadur Shastri International Airport | |
|---|---|---|
| Code | VNKT / KTM | VEBN / VNS |
| Longest hard runway | 10,991 ft | 9,006 ft |
| Surface | Asphalt | Asphalt |
| Field elevation | 4,390 ft | 266 ft |
All 21 aircraft we quote for Kathmandu to Varanasi can use both airfields and fly the route non-stop. Tribhuvan International Airport has 10,991 ft and Lal Bahadur Shastri International Airport 9,006 ft, both comfortably beyond the 6,000 ft the largest types here need, so field length is not what decides the aircraft on this route — cabin size and range are.
